Robert David Hall (born November 9, 1947 in East Orange , New Jersey ) is an American actor .

Life

Robert David Hall graduated from UCLA with a degree in English Literature in 1971 . In 1978 he was involved in a serious car accident. Both of his legs had to be amputated because over 65% of his skin was burned. He has been using prostheses ever since. He has been married to his third wife, Judy Stearns, since 1999. From 1971 to 1974 he was married to Susan Petroni. His second marriage to Connie Cole had a son.

He had his first role in 1983 in the film The Bomb Shop . This was followed by several other films and numerous guest appearances on television series such as LA Law - Star Lawyers, Tricks, Trials , Beverly Hills, 90210 , A Wink des Heaven , A Touch Of Heaven , The West Wing - In the Center of Power and Practice - The Lawyers .

Since 2000 he has played in the successful television series CSI: Vegas . Actually, he should only appear in one of the first episodes of the series. However, his role was expanded and thus he became one of the main characters in the series from 2002. Due to the great success of this series, he became a passionate advocate of the interests of disabled actors.

Awards

  • 2002: Nomination for the Screen Actors Guild Award in the category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series
  • 2003: Nomination for the Screen Actors Guild Award in the category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series
  • 2004: Nomination for the Screen Actors Guild Award in the category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series
  • 2005: Screen Actors Guild Award for Outstanding Performance by an Ensemble in a Drama Series
